** 02-Nov-2021 World View: Cutting the internet
Guest wrote:
Mon Nov 01, 2021 7:45 pm
> We turned off North Korea's Internet in 2015 over the Sony
> hack. Why couldn't we do that to China?
In December 2014, after the Sony hack, the North Korea internet was
out for 9 hours and 31 minutes. North Korea's internet had only one
connection to the outside world, and that's through China. China was
accused of being responsible for the North Korea outage, but denied
it. If the US was responsible, it would have been through a
cyber-attack in retaliation for the Sony hack, but there's no evidence
of that. The other possibility is that the outage was caused by an
internal problem within North Korea. As far as I know, the cause of
the outage has never been determined with certainty.

China's internet has multiple connections to the outside world, so
there's no single point of failure as there is for North Korea, so
there is no way to cut China's internet connection to the outside
world.
